I'm a pragmatic full stack developer focused on building tools that work hard and stay out of the way.

By day, I'm building with Laravel and Livewire to support complex internal systems. I care about writing code that gets used, simplifying operations, and shipping fast without cutting corners.

Outside of work, I experiment with tools that support more mindful digital habits. I built Grasp, a browser plugin that helps you save links with intention and actually follow through. I'm also testing Ollama to automate redundant dev tasks locally. It's part of a broader interest in building small, AI-enhanced tools that stay personal and purposeful.
